As a follow -up to Kathy's doggy note - the dog 'park' is not currently installed. The entry to the 'natural area' goes thru some agricultural fields which I presume may be the intended off leash area as they could be fenced off (as at Marymoor Park). This may be the plan here - maybe concerned tweeters could inquire to the county and give some imput. I would imagine that with all the habitat work the county has done there, that they would'nt plan to allow off leash dogs everywhere at this site. Communication to Snohomish Co. Parks might be helpful.

Jeff Gibson provided some interesting information on this community park in Snohomish County. I Googled it and found this information at a Snohomish County web site:
[T]he Off-Leash Dog Park originally planned for Fobes Hill Community Park will be constructed at Fields Riffle Community Park.
